dosed -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 :

  Dose \Dose\, v. t. [imp. & p. p. Dosed; p. pr. & vb. n.
     dosing.] [Cf. F. doser. See Dose, n.]
     1. To proportion properly (a medicine), with reference to the
        patient or the disease; to form into suitable doses.
        [1913 Webster]
  
     2. To give doses to; to medicine or physic to; to give
        potions to, constantly and without need.
        [1913 Webster]
  
              A self-opinioned physician, worse than his
              distemper, who shall dose, and bleed, and kill him,
              "secundum artem."                     -- South
        [1913 Webster]
  
     3. To give anything nauseous to.
        [1913 Webster]

dosed - WordNet (r) 2.1 (2005) :

  dosed
      adj 1: treated with some kind of application; "a mustache dosed
             with bear grease"
